Dr. Sathiya Maran is a Lecturer at the Malaysia School of Pharmacy, Monash University. She holds a PhD in Human Genetics from Universiti Sains Malaysia and completed a postdoctoral fellowship in Human Genetics and Data Sciences at Perdana University (2019). Her research focuses on genetic variations in non-communicable diseases (e.g., cardiovascular diseases, Helicobacter pylori infection), next-generation sequencing, and bioinformatics. Notable achievements include the 'Gold Award' for bone implant innovation (2024) and a HUGO Travel Grant (2025). She leads projects like 'Understanding the role of MYH in congenital heart defects' (2022–2026) and collaborates on initiatives such as the 1Malaysia Human Genome Variome Consortium.

Research interests span molecular medicine, computational biology, and genomic tools for personalized medicine. She actively engages in workshops, such as the 'Hands-On Training in Molecular Docking' (2025), and contributes to community initiatives like 'Pulse of Hope: Congenital Heart Defect Awareness Day' (2025).

Projects include advanced bone graft materials, CRISPR/Cas9 gene-editing for congenital heart defects, and microbial influence on cardiovascular diseases. Her work aligns with UN SDG 3 (Good Health and Well-being).
